      Dark Souls 1 PvP Overhaul and Prepare to Die Edition SFX may be incompatible. Both contain a replacement for FRPG_SfxBnd_CommonEffects.ffxbnd.dcx which is the file that contains most of the sfxs. I think that's where the problem is coming from.

      Late answer, but this mod and PVP overhaul are actually compatible! All you need to do is extract the files from this mod not into "DARK SOULS REMASTERED/sfx" as usual, but into "DARK SOULS REMASTERED/overhaul", the folder of the PVP overhaul mod. I think the PVP overhaul mod has some internal logic to overwrite all sfx files if it has them, but you can actually overwrite FRPG_SfxBnd_CommonEffects.ffxbnd.dcx with the one from this mod and PVP overhaul will still work without problems.

      I'm still not satisfied with the mod's name, Prepare to Die Edition SFX is short and descriptive but you'd have to know what are PtDE and SFXs to undertsand it.
      SFX is the term used in Dark Souls game files for special effects, the mod being a replacement for the sfx folder. Besides, if you google SFX, you'd have a pinned wikipedia article for special effects.
      Moreover I think SFX (Special effects) and VFX are not the same, to my understanding VFX is a term more often used for post processing enhancements, which the mod is not since it replaces models/ sprites textures.
      That being said I totally agree that the term SFX is confusing, I just didn't find a better way to name the mod.
